GERARD BUTLER - BUTLER TO STAR IN PHANTOM SEQUEL?

Scottish actor GERARD BUTLER is the favourite to star in the West End sequel to THE PHANTOM OF THE OPERA.
The 300 star impressed creator Sir Andrew Lloyd Webber with his performance as the Phantom in the 2004 film of the same name - and the theatre impresario now wants Butler to reprise the famous role for his forthcoming stage sequel.
Lloyd Webber tells British newspaper the Daily Express. "I have got my own new show coming on next year, which is my sequel to The Phantom of the Opera, which I think is going to be called Phantom: Once Upon Another Time. That will come on in November next year, if everything goes well."
And although Butler hasn't confirmed his involvement in the project, he is the main contender for the part.
A source close to Webber reveals, "Because it's a sequel to a film which helped the career rise of Gerard, Lord Andrew believes he will do it. There could be another film down the line. There's a massive audience out there who love the original."
